About the role

This is an exciting opportunity to support the day-to-day manufacture of EA Technology’s hardware products, ensuring technical issues are resolved quickly and efficiently to maintain quality and production throughput. Working as part of our Production Engineering team, you will focus on improving manufacturability, supporting released products and driving continuous improvements across our manufacturing processes.

Responsibilities
  • Support day-to-day manufacturing and build activities by resolving technical issues that impact quality or production throughput
  • Maintain work instructions, build methods and engineering documentation to ensure consistent production standards
  • Investigate build and test failures, implementing approved corrective actions and escalating design-related issues where appropriate
  • Work closely with production and quality teams to ensure engineering changes are implemented accurately and safely
  • Support line balancing, workstation improvements and process changes to reduce waste and rework
  • Provide engineering input into tooling, fixtures and build aids to improve manufacturability and consistency
  • Analyse production data to identify recurring issues and opportunities for continuous improvement
  • Support the training and coaching of production staff on technical processes and engineering changes
  • Promote safe working practices and ensure compliance with engineering and quality standards
  • Collaborate with manufacturing partners and internal teams to improve production processes and resolve build issues
